2003 Honda accord v6 ex- battery drain
I have a 2003 Honda accord v6 ex. The battery keeps dying. Jumped it off about 5 hours ago & it's dead again. When I open the door the dash lights come on & the ignition switch dings like the key is in. Please help if you can!
Are you sure the alternator is charging it? If so, then you'll be looking for some parasitic drain. Look for the easy stuff first, like a trunk lamp the doesn't turn off. Brake lamps stuck on?
Otherwise, it could be an alternator problem.

Did you have the battery tested? I agree with Jim the charging system and a draw are "in play" but I have to add a battery that can't hold a charge is in play as well. An '03, figure 5 years (avg life of a lead/acid battery), you are due for a third battery by the stat's.
